πŸ“œ What happened on June 27th?

Below are some of the important historical events that happened on June 27.

1542
Juan Rodriguez Cabrillo sets sail from the Mexican port of Navidad to explore the west coast of North America on behalf of the Spanish Empire.

1693
1st women's magazine "Ladies' Mercury" published (London).

1743
War of the Austrian Succession: Battle of Dettingen: in Bavaria, King George II of Britain personally leads troops into battle. The last time a British monarch commanded troops in the field.

1929
1st color TV demo, performed by Bell Laboratories in NYC.

1950
North Korean troops reach Seoul, UN asks members to aid South Korea, Harry Truman orders US Air Force & Navy into Korean conflict.

1954
1st atomic power station opens - Obninsk, near Moscow in Russia.

The moonstone was named by the Roman naturalist Pliny, who believed that the stone’s appearance changed with the phases of the moon. It is also known as the β€œtraveler’s stone” and has a reputation for protecting travelers at night and over water.

Alexandrite was named after the Russian Czar Alexander II, who came of age on the day the gem was discovered in 1834, according to legend. It was found in Russian emerald mines, and its colors change from bluish green in daylight to a purplish red when viewed beneath the light of an incandescent bulb. Poets have called it an "emerald by day, a ruby by night."
